Results: There was no evidence to suggest that the use of loop diuretics in AKI reduces mortality, the need for dialysis, the number of dialysis sessions, or length of Intensive Care Unit/hospital stay or that it increases the recovery of renal function.
Why are loop diuretics effective in renal failure?
Their pharmacokinetic and pharmacodynamic properties give them a high efficacy, even in severely compromised renal function. The serum elimination half-life and duration of action of most loop diuretics are dependent on the glomerular filtration rate and are therefore prolonged in renal failure.
Do diuretics improve outcomes in acute kidney injury?
Although diuretics are used commonly in AKI, there is no clear evidence that they improve outcomes in AKI. According to Mehta et al.,13who studied 552 patients with acute renal failure, diuretic use was associated with an increased in-hospital mortality and nonrecovery of renal function.

How do you nonsteroidal anti inflammatory drugs cause acute kidney injury quizlet?
NSAIDs disrupt the compensatory vasodilation response of renal prostaglandins to vasoconstrictor hormones released by the body [5]. Inhibition of renal prostaglandins results in acute deterioration of renal function after ingestion of NSAIDs.
Why is furosemide used in AKI?
Third, furosemide can increase the urinary excretion of water, sodium, potassium, acids, and calcium in patients who are still responsive to furosemide. As such, furosemide can be useful for reducing the severity of hyperkalaemia, acidosis, and fluid overload in mild AKI.
Do diuretics improve kidney function?
Summary: Diuretics are ineffective and even detrimental in the prevention and treatment of AKI, and neither shorten the duration of AKI, nor reduce the need for renal replacement therapy. Diuretics have an important role in volume management in AKI, but they are not recommended for the prevention of AKI.

Why do loop diuretics work in renal failure?
In some patients with oliguric form of acute renal failure (ARF), loop diuretics increase sodium excretion and urine output. They do not affect the mortality rate for ARF but may facilitate the treatment of patients by reverting an oliguric form to a non-oliguric form of ARF.
Why do loop diuretics cause AKI?
Furthermore, loop diuretics block sodium chloride uptake in the macula densa, independent of any effect on sodium and water balance, thereby stimulating the RAAS, and leading to AKI. Recently, some trials13.
How do loop diuretics work?
How do loop diuretics work? They work by making the kidneys pass out more fluid. They do this by interfering with the transport of salt and water across certain cells in the kidneys. (These cells are in a structure called the loop of Henle - hence the name loop diuretic.

How do loop diuretics reach their target site?
They reach their target site by active secretion from the blood into the urine by the organic acid transporters present in the proximal tubules. Hypoalbuminemia (which is common in patients with AKI in the ICU) leads to a decreased secretion into the tubules and an increased clearance of loop diuretics.

How do loop diuretics affect the henle?
Loop diuretics might decrease the oxygen consumption of the thick ascending limb of Henle by interfering with its function and thus protect it from ischemia. Loop diuretics inhibit prostaglandin dehydrogenase, as a result of which there is a decreased breakdown of prostaglandin E2which is a renal vasodilator.

Do loop diuretics help with fluid overload?
However, critically ill patients often receive large volumes of fluids. Loop diuretics in such patients minimize fluid overload and may make patient management easier. On the basis of the current evidence, therefore, the use of diuretics should be limited to the management of volume overload and/or hyperkalemia.
Can loop diuretics be used with albumin?
The diuretic effect of loop diuretics is therefore considerably reduced in the presence of hypoalbuminemia.4Other highly protein-bound drugs such as phenytoin or warfarin may also decrease the action of loop diuretics. There is a theoretical rationale, therefore, for combining loop diuretics with an albumin infusion.

Is torasemide a loop diuretic?
Torasemide, a new high ceiling and long acting loop diuretic, is as potent as furosemide (frusemide) in patients with advanced renal failure. Unlike other loop diuretics, the half-life and duration of action of torasemide are not dependent on renal function and the parent drug does not accumulate in renal failure.
